Transaction 99e21e201e043ad07048775eff045a03bde19b073dbf904eb24fa9a84f08b33f

1 Input
2 Outputs
  • 99e21e201e043ad07048775eff045a03bde19b073dbf904eb24fa9a84f08b33f:0
  • value  1070921
    address  3LDUKaStVzT2RnFyqWZRtNKaRKcoiXTfLx
  • 99e21e201e043ad07048775eff045a03bde19b073dbf904eb24fa9a84f08b33f:1
  • value  40937
    address  3HUaRSbeXD7dKbn5BJawuDqzKaZoLbRDiG